Part Details | SPRING TENSION CLIP
5340-00-598-6462 A preformed item of semirigid material designed to retain, position, fasten, or support other items, such as cable(s), access cover(s), by its own inherent spring action. It may be fastened to a structure by bolt(s), clip(s), screw(s), and the like. For items conducting electric current, see CLIP, ELECTRICAL or CLAMP, ELECTRICAL. For items which partially surround an item, see STRAP, RETAINING. For items which entirely surround an item and do not have inherent spring tension, see CLAMP, LOOP. See also CLIP, RETAINING. Do not use if a more specific item name is available.
